Keynote Speaker
Mary Gordon, Founder/President/CEO
Roots of Empathy
Mary Gordon is recognized internationally as an award-winning social entrepreneur, educator, best-selling author, child advocate and parenting expert who has created programs informed by the power of empathy.
In 1981, Ms. Gordon founded Canada’s first and largest Parenting and Family Literacy Centers, for which she received the Order of Canada. In 1996, she created the Roots of Empathy program, after which she named her international children's charity which now offers programs on three continents.
